The MPLAD18KP51A belongs to the category of trans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diodes.
It is used to protect sensitive electronic components from voltage transients induced by lightning, electrostatic discharge (ESD), and other transient voltage events.
The MPLAD18KP51A is available in a DO-203AB package.
The essence of MPLAD18KP51A lies in its ability to provide robust protection against transient voltage events, thereby safeguarding electronic circuits and components.
The MPLAD18KP51A is typically packaged in reels and is available in varying quantities depending on the supplier.
The MPLAD18KP51A TVS diode has a standard two-pin configuration with anode and cathode terminals.
The MPLAD18KP51A operates based on the principle of avalanche breakdown, where it rapidly diverts excessive transient currents away from sensitive components, thereby limiting the voltage across the protected circuit.
The MPLAD18KP51A is commonly used in various applications including: - Telecommunication equipment - Industrial control systems - Power supplies - Automotive electronics - Consumer electronics
